For lovers of the Mexican bakery, we created this recipe for the traditional goblets of cheese with a crunchy crust and creamy filling, decorated with icing sugar and fresh strawberries. Do not miss trying them!

Preparation
Preheat oven to 190 ° C (374F)
On a clean surface, forms a volcano with flour, sugar and salt. Add the butter and work with a scraper to form a "sand point". Add the egg and vanilla essence, knead until integrated.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
Form balls of dough and place them on a mold of cupcakes, extend to form the base. Refrigerate for 15 minutes more.
For the filling, liquefy the eggs with condensed milk, cream cheese, vanilla essence and cornstarch.
Pour the previous mixture on the butter bases to ¾ of its capacity and bake 10 minutes. Lower the oven temperature to 180 ° C (356F)and bake 10 to 15 minutes more or until the filling is firm and the edges golden. Chill and decorate with icing sugar and strawberries.
